Hello, i don't know if that helps you but i am using a Gigabyte GA-B85-HD3 along with an i3 4330 which is awesome for the price!! I didn't check if microcenter has the mobo but i found it in amazon http://www.amazon.com/Gigabyte-GA-B85-HD3--LGA1150-Chipset-Motherboard/dp/B00FMIB7HK/. It works perfect with OS X as it is fully  compatible and it is budget as you want it.
